Defines interoperability and security related requirements for using encipherment at the physical layer of the ISO Open Systems Interconnection (OSI) Reference Model in telecommunication systems conveying Automatic Data Processing (ADP) information. Facilitates interoperation of data encipherment equipment. Applicable mainly to various encipherment algorithms. Annex B provides additional requirements for using DEA and applies to synchronous and asynchronous operation in full and half duplex modes. Specifies delayed option and immediate option als incompatible modes of synchronous operation.
